Biography of Iggy Azalea

Iggy Azalea, born Amethyst Amelia Kelly on June 7, 1990, in Sydney, Australia, is a rapper, singer, songwriter, and model. She moved to the United States at the age of 16 to pursue her music career and quickly gained recognition for her unique sound and style.

Early Life

Iggy grew up in a working-class family, where she was exposed to various musical genres from an early age. Inspired by artists like Missy Elliott and Tupac Shakur, she began rapping as a teenager and quickly developed her distinct artistic identity.

Iggy Azalea's Musical Career

Iggy Azalea's career took off with her debut mixtape, "Ignorant Art," released in 2011. However, it was her single "Fancy" featuring Charli XCX that catapulted her to international fame in 2014. The song topped charts worldwide, and its accompanying music video showcased Iggy's signature dance moves, including twerking.

Breakthrough Album

In 2014, Iggy released her first studio album, "The New Classic." The album was critically acclaimed and commercial success, featuring hit singles like "Problem" and "Black Widow." Iggy's unique blend of rap and pop appealed to a diverse audience and solidified her position in the music industry.

Controversies Surrounding Iggy Azalea

Despite her success, Iggy Azalea has faced criticism and controversies throughout her career, particularly regarding cultural appropriation and her lyrical content. These issues have sparked discussions about race and identity in the music industry.
